Output 34a96f546501f64cc3bae8350d8a0e7c96f4084909e0a4f19d4694e4723b2ac6:1

value
9328879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d974d8afbb27a2612f7d18703b9be23ae453b7 OP_EQUAL
address
3G5eWoHdJrZL81oHxG6WXqEriipuGkVwmL
transaction
34a96f546501f64cc3bae8350d8a0e7c96f4084909e0a4f19d4694e4723b2ac6
confirmations
156887
spent
true